#container{
width:90%;
margin:auto;
}
h1{
font-size:1.2em;
}
h2{
font-size:1em;
}
h3{
font-size:.9em;
}
h4{
font-size:.8em;
}
h5{
font-size:.7em;
}
h6{
font-size:.6em;
}

body{
background:url(back.png);
background-repeat:repeat-x;
background-color: #000000;
}
#head{
color:black;
width:100%;
text-align:center;
/*background:white;*/
}
#nav{
float:left;
width:10%;
margin:1em;
color:black;
border:solid black .5em;
background:#FFFFFF;
}
#content{
float:right;
width:75%;
margin: 1em;
background:#FFFFFF;
border:solid black .5em;
padding:1em;
overflow:auto;
}
#footer{
clear:both;
width:20%;
margin-left:auto;
margin-right:auto;
background:#FFFFFF;
border:solid black .5em;
text-align:center;
bottom: 5%
}
.title{
text-align:left;
}
.form{
text-align:right;
}
img{
border:0px;
}
.warn{
color:#cc0000;
font-size:2em;
}
ul{

}
